Expert Insights

From a sector and equity valuation perspective, Alibaba (BABA)’s strategic bet on Hong Kong as its international AI hub aligns with our baseline forecast that the firm will derive 25% of its total overseas revenue from ASEAN markets by 2030, up from 12% in 2025. The city’s relatively flexible cross-border data transfer rules (compared to mainland China) and deep pool of bilingual tech, legal and compliance talent reduce execution risk for Alibaba’s global rollout of cloud and generative AI enterprise offerings, while its robust patent framework protects the firm’s international AI intellectual property assets. For investors, this strategic positioning could reduce the geopolitical risk premium priced into Alibaba’s overseas operating segments, supporting a 10-15% upside re-rating for these business lines over the next 24 months, assuming successful execution of the city’s AI development roadmap. For the broader market, Hong Kong’s pivot beyond pure-play AI IPO financing addresses a critical structural gap in the global AI ecosystem. As of 2026, HSBC estimates that geopolitical regulatory fragmentation is suppressing approximately $1.2 trillion in potential cross-border AI trade across the Indo-Pacific region. The city’s unique status under the “one country, two systems” framework positions it as a neutral test bed for harmonizing cross-border AI standards, connecting mainland Chinese AI innovation, Southeast Asian market demand and Western governance frameworks. That said, material execution risks remain: Hong Kong faces stiff competition from Singapore for ASEAN AI headquarters relocations, as the latter currently offers more generous grant packages for early-stage AI startups, and will require close regulatory coordination with Greater Bay Area peers to avoid duplicating R&D investments. Over the long term, however, the city’s first-mover advantage in AI fundraising and established professional services ecosystem give it a tangible edge over regional peers in capturing a share of the $18 trillion global AI value pool projected by 2030.
